3.2.2. Results deletion
This special cycle erase all the results stored in the instrument. The results will be
definitively deleted. It is advisable to save them first if archiving or later statistic
treatments are required. For the save, see the Winateq300 software user manual.
Press on the key (brief press) to enter in the
Special Cycles menu.
